Bowman Q2 2022 Earnings Report
Key Takeaways
Bowman Consulting Group reported record second-quarter results, with a 74% increase in net service revenue year-over-year. This growth was fueled by a 32% organic increase and contributions from ten acquisitions. The company has also increased its full-year outlook due to strong year-to-date results and record backlog.
Net service revenue increased by 74% year-over-year.
Organic net service billing growth was 32%.
Adjusted EBITDA increased by 81% year-over-year.
The company increased its full year 2022 outlook for Net Service Billing and Adjusted EBITDA.

Forward Guidance
The Company is increasing its full year 2022 outlook for Net Service Billing to be in the range of $205 to $220 million and Adjusted EBITDA in the range of $29 to $33 million.
Positive Outlook
- Net Service Billing to be in the range of $205 to $220 million.
- Adjusted EBITDA in the range of $29 to $33 million.
- Increase from the previous guidance for Net Service Billing of $185 to $200 million.
- Increase from the previous guidance for Adjusted EBITDA of $25 to $29 million.
- The Company expects to continue making strategic and financially accretive acquisitions.
